What is cancelled organic certifications?
Cancelled organic certifications refer to the annulment of a previously granted organic certification status to a farm or processing operation, indicating that it no longer meets the required standards for organic production.
Who is required to file cancelled organic certifications?
Any organic operation that has had its organic certification cancelled must file a cancelled organic certification form with the relevant certifying body to formally acknowledge the cancellation.
How to fill out cancelled organic certifications?
To fill out cancelled organic certifications, operators should provide their contact information, specify the reason for cancellation, and include any relevant documentation or evidence associated with the cancellation.
What is the purpose of cancelled organic certifications?
The purpose of cancelled organic certifications is to maintain the integrity of the organic certification system by officially documenting when an operation no longer complies with organic standards.
What information must be reported on cancelled organic certifications?
The information that must be reported includes the operation's name, address, certification number, cancellation reason, and any pertinent dates related to the certification status.
